Musicians finally get a travel reprieve with new goverment rules

  BY RANDY LEWIS, LOS ANGELES TIMES JUN 02, 2013 3:45 AM Musicians can breathe a little easier while traveling, with the submission to Congress of a U.S. Department of Agriculture report addressing provisions of the Lacey Act that protect endangered wildlife, fish and plants. Enormous Rolling Stones Exhibit Launched at Rock and Roll Hall of Fame

A newly-opened exhibit at the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ame Museum is offering a plethora of riches for Rolling Stones fans. The museum is devoting nearly three floors to Rolling Stones: 50 Years of Satisfaction, a comprehensive retrospective filled with artifacts, film, text and interactive media.
